How the model works

Legend

  • Sales
  • Fixed costs
  • Variable costs
  • Contribution margin — the share of every euro of sales left after variable costs. If variable costs are 60% of revenue, the margin is 40%
  • ROMA — return on marketing and adv spend: euros of sales generated per euro invested across all marketing spend (a ROMA of 4 = €4 of sales for every €1 spent)
  • BERT — Break-Even ROAS Threshold: the minimum ROMA (1/M) below which break-even is impossible at any revenue

The reasoning

Profit is what's left after subtracting all costs:

Profit = Sales − Variable costs − marketing spend − Fixed costs

Two of these costs depend on sales. Variable costs are a fixed share of revenue, and marketing spend is revenue divided by ROMA:

Variable costs = (1 − M) · Sales      Marketing spend = SalesROMA

Substituting and factoring out Sales, profit becomes:

Profit = Sales · ( M − 1ROMA ) − Fixed costs

Break-even is where profit is zero. Solving for sales gives the break-even revenue:

Break-even revenue = Fixed costsM − 1/ROMA

The denominator M − 1/ROMA is the contribution margin on every euro of revenue: what's left of each euro sold after variable costs and marketing. It's the purple curve on the chart, available via the toggle.

There's an important condition: break-even only exists if the margin exceeds the marketing cost per euro sold. In other words, ROMA must be greater than:

ROMA > 1M   (BERT)

Below this threshold every sale loses money: selling more does not get you to break-even, it pushes it further away.
